A classic, healthy combination where chicken thighs and broccoli florets roast together with lemon juice and garlic. This meal is high in protein and fiber, requiring only ten minutes of prep time before going into the oven.
Individual foil packets keep salmon fillets moist while steaming alongside tender asparagus spears. This method requires minimal cleanup and ensures perfectly portioned meals for kids and adults alike.
Pre-cooked sausage links are threaded with bell peppers and onions for easy handling and even cooking. This colorful, kid-friendly dish offers a familiar flavor profile that appeals to picky eaters.
Canned tuna and canned white beans are tossed with olive oil, oregano, and cherry tomatoes on a sheet pan. This vegetarian option is rich in omega-3s and plant-based protein, ready in under 20 minutes.
Diced sweet potatoes and diced onions are roasted until crispy, then topped with cracked eggs to bake. This savory breakfast-for-dinner option is nutrient-dense and provides sustained energy for busy evenings.
Thinly sliced beef strips are tossed in a homemade teriyaki glaze and roasted alongside broccoli florets. The high heat caramelizes the sauce slightly, creating a flavorful meal that pairs well with quick-cooking rice.
Quick-cooking shrimp are seasoned with Cajun spices and roasted alongside frozen corn kernels and bell peppers. This seafood dish is ready in just 12 minutes, making it ideal for unexpectedly late dinners.
Halved zucchini are stuffed with crumbled Italian sausage and marinara sauce, then baked until tender. This low-carb option is hearty and satisfying, allowing parents to sneak extra vegetables into their kids' diet.
Sliced chicken breast is cooked with sliced fajita vegetables and topped with melted cheese on a sheet pan. This versatile meal can be served over rice or in tortillas for a customizable family dinner.
Salmon fillets are spread with basil pesto and roasted alongside fresh green beans trimmed and seasoned. The aromatic pesto adds depth of flavor without requiring complex sauces or additional side dishes.
Lean ground beef is stir-fried with Korean BBQ sauce and served over cauliflower rice or roasted broccoli. This low-carb, high-flavor meal satisfies cravings for takeout while being much healthier and faster to prepare.
Thick-cut pork chops are glazed with honey mustard and roasted with sliced apples for a sweet and savory contrast. The apples soften into a sauce-like consistency, complementing the tender pork perfectly.
Chickpeas are tossed with olive oil, cumin, and crumbled feta cheese, then baked until crispy. This vegan-friendly dish is packed with protein and fiber, offering a quick and affordable vegetarian option.
Small steak cubes are seared or roasted alongside diced baby potatoes and garlic butter. This hearty meal feels indulgent yet is straightforward to execute, providing a comforting dinner after a long day.
Chicken strips are glazed with a sticky peanut sauce and roasted with matchstick carrots. The sweet and spicy flavors mimic popular restaurant dishes, offering a familiar taste that children usually enjoy.
